The Healer of Aster
In the spellbinding world of Aster, where magic is as real as the air we breathe, lived the renowned healer, Elaria. The daughter of a simple blacksmith, her magical abilities were discovered quite unexpectedly while trying to heal her father’s injured hand. Astonished by her untrained power, the elders sent her to the prestigious Magical Academy, where she honed her healing abilities over the years.
Elaria was gentle and kind-hearted, often going beyond her way to heal those in need without expecting any returns. However, using her healing powers drained her energy significantly, and each time she healed a wound, she had a short moment of weakness. Despite the risk, Elaria continued to use her gift, driven by her mission to cure the ill and infirm.
In the same city lived a ruthless warlord named Azarkon who lusted for eternal power. He was infamous for his savage conquests and his hunger for magic which he sought to gather through cruel means, often enslaving magical creatures to do his bidding. Learning about Elaria’s miraculous healing abilities, Azarkon hatched a wicked plan to attain immortality. He intended to capture Elaria and force her to heal his wounds constantly, rendering him virtually impervious to any harm.
Azarkon sent his menacing troops to capture the kind-hearted healer. Elaria, anticipating his vile intentions, fled from Proxima City to the wild lands of Aster, evading capture. As she journeyed through icy mountains and dark forests, she used her healing gifts on the sick and the wounded she met along the way, living up to her title as the ‘Healer of Aster.'
Meanwhile, the relentless pursuit by Azarkon's troops led to Elaria's exhaustion. She was on the verge of collapse, when she stumbled upon a hidden tribe of mystical beings known as the Shaebores, dwelling in the enchanted Keira Woods. The Shaebores, despite being isolationists, took her in, moved by Elaria’s self-inflicting weakened state. Their elder sensed Elaria's noble spirit and the dire circumstance she was in. The tribe decided to break their millennia-old custom and taught Elaria how to restore her magical energy using the ancient relic 'Gaia’s Tear', a luminous gem with the ability to restore a magic user’s strength.
Elaria, rejuvenated and armed with the new knowledge, returned to Proxima City to confront Azarkon. Predicting his wicked plan of enslaving her, she tricked him into thinking she was surrendering herself. As Azarkon, gleeful at his victory, rushed towards her, Elaria used her healing abilities at an unimaginable scale, creating a wave of energy that poured into the warlord.
Azarkon, thinking he was becoming immortal, reveled in the surge of magic but soon realized his mistake. Elaria was not granting him immortality, but attempting to heal his lust for power and cruelty. Azarkon writhed in pain as he felt his malicious urges being expelled. When the wave subsided, Elaria collapsed due to exhaustion from her overexertion while Azarkon, no longer the ruthless warlord, was filled with remorse.
Elaria woke up to find herself in her father’s house, with the city folk gathered around her. They hailed her the hero, the bringer of peace. Azarkon, thereafter, left his past behind and devoted his life to make amends for his atrocities, helping the city return to its former glory.
And so, Elaria’s name resonated throughout Aster, the legendary healer who mended not just physical wounds but healed a heart of darkness. Elaria continued to live her life, humbly helping others, her story becoming a tale of hope and courage sung for generations to come.
